- 1. a. Capable of being taxed; liable by law to the assessment of taxes; as, taxable estate; taxable commodities. Source: opted
- 2. a. That may be legally charged by a court against the plaintiff of defendant in a suit; as, taxable costs. Source: opted
- 3. adj. (of goods or funds) subject to taxation Source: wordnet
